C++从入门到起飞之——初始化列表&类型转换&static成员 全方位剖析! 在C++中,初始化列表、类型转换和static成员是理解面向对象编程和C++语言特性的关键概念。本文将对这三者进行全方位的剖析,并通过代码示例来帮助读者更好地理解。一、初始化列表初始化列表是构造函数的一部分,用于在对象被创建时初始化成员变量。它的优点在于可以在构造函数中直接初始化常量成员、引用成 后端 2024年10月04日 0 点赞 0 评论 91 浏览
[Javase]基于C快速入门 Java是一种广泛使用的编程语言,以其简单性和跨平台性而闻名。而C语言则是一种底层语言,适用于操作系统和嵌入式系统开发。对于有C语言基础的程序员来说,学习Java可以说是相对轻松的,因为它们之间有一些相似的概念和语法。下面,我们将快速入门Java,并通过一些示例代码对比C语言和Java的异同。1. 后端 2024年10月17日 0 点赞 0 评论 92 浏览
[项目][WebServer][ThreadPool]详细讲解 WebServer中的线程池详解在开发一个Web服务器时,性能和响应能力是关键因素之一。为了有效管理处理请求的过程,线程池被广泛使用。线程池是一种设计模式,用于管理和复用多个线程,避免频繁创建和销毁线程所带来的开销,提高系统的性能和资源利用率。什么是线程池?线程池就是预先创建好一组线程,放入池 前端 2024年09月27日 0 点赞 0 评论 92 浏览
华为OD机试E卷 - 分苹果(Java & Python& JS & C++ & C ) 华为OD机试E卷 - 分苹果在软件开发和算法设计中,分苹果问题是一个经典的组合数学问题。我们以此为基础,使用不同的编程语言对其进行实现。假设我们有若干个苹果,目标是将这些苹果分给一些小朋友,使得每个小朋友至少能够分到一个苹果。我们的任务是计算出分配的方案数。问题定义给定 n 个苹果和 k 个小 后端 2024年10月21日 0 点赞 0 评论 93 浏览
【JAVA面试题】Java和C++主要区别有哪些?各有哪些优缺点? 在软件开发领域,Java和C++都是非常流行的编程语言,各自在不同的场景中发挥着重要作用。虽然两者都属于面向对象的语言,并且有许多相似之处,但它们也存在许多显著的区别。下面将从几个方面对Java和C++的主要区别及各自的优缺点进行探讨。1. 内存管理Java:Java采用自动垃圾回收机制(Gar 后端 2024年10月10日 0 点赞 0 评论 95 浏览
华为OD机试E卷 - 字符串变换最小字符串(Java & Python& JS & C++ & C ) 在进行字符串处理时,字符串变换是一个常见的问题。尤其是在大型软件开发和算法竞赛中,理解如何最小化字符串变换的代价是非常重要的。本文将探讨如何在不同的编程语言中实现字符串变换最小字符串的相关算法,主要以Java、Python、JavaScript、C++和C语言为例。问题定义假设我们有两个字符串 后端 2024年10月20日 0 点赞 0 评论 97 浏览
C++ webrtc开发(非原生开发,linux上使用libdatachannel库) 在现代网络通信中,WebRTC(Web Real-Time Communication)已经成为一个重要的技术,允许浏览器和移动应用直接进行实时音视频通信。在Linux系统上,我们可以使用libdatachannel库来实现WebRTC功能。libdatachannel是一个轻量级的C++库,旨在提 前端 2024年10月14日 0 点赞 0 评论 97 浏览
valorant(无畏契约)Ai瞄准、cf(穿越火线)Ai瞄准以及各类的fps游戏Ai识别所使用的通用技术分享(python版本) 在现代游戏领域,人工智能(AI)已经不仅限于对战策略的制定与非玩家角色(NPC)的行为调整,它也被广泛应用于第一人称射击(FPS)游戏中,实现了自动瞄准和目标识别等功能。无论是《无畏契约》(Valorant)、《穿越火线》(CrossFire)还是其他各类FPS游戏,AI瞄准技术的实现主要依赖于图像 后端 2024年10月16日 0 点赞 0 评论 98 浏览
2024华为OD机试最新E卷题库-(C卷+D卷+E卷)-(JAVA、Python、C++) 2024年华为OD机试的最新E卷题库(包含C卷、D卷和E卷)涵盖了多种编程语言,包括Java、Python和C++。随着技术的进步和行业需求的变化,这些题库不仅考察了基本的数据结构和算法知识,还注重实际的编码能力以及编程的思维方式。在此,我将分析几个常见的类型题目,并提供相应的代码示例。一、数组与 后端 2024年09月29日 0 点赞 0 评论 98 浏览
【Linux】信号的保存 在Linux操作系统中,信号是一种重要的进程间通信(IPC)机制,用于通知进程发生了某个事件。信号通常用于处理异步事件,如定时器、用户中断或进程间的变化等。在某些情况下,进程可能需要保存信号的状态,以便在信号处理完成后继续执行原来的工作。本文将介绍信号的保存机制,并通过代码示例演示如何在C语言中实现 前端 2024年09月22日 0 点赞 0 评论 98 浏览